我正在学习Android和youtube上的教程,比如:
假设我需要Java。
然而,当我在网站上浏览教程时:
https://developer.android.com/training/basics/firstapp/creating-project.html
我能够设置并运行myfirstapp应用程序项目。
是新的,包括SDK,还是我将需要它为更复杂的项目。
我想我可以只运行视频教程,直到遇到问题,但我想知道之前,我必须卸载Android,安装JDK和重新安装Android。
看上去真的很痛苦。
发布于 2017-02-11 03:59:25
AndroidStudioVersion2.2和更高版本提供了最新的嵌入式OpenJDK,以便为初学者提供一个较低的进入门槛。
但是,建议您自己安装JDK,因为这样您就可以独立于Android更新它了。
如果您使用的是Android < 24,那么您需要使用Java7编译这个项目,或者对启用Java 8功能执行一些额外的步骤。(注意: Java 8支持相对较新)。
AndroidStudio3.0及更高版本支持所有Java 7语言特性和Java 8语言特性的子集
发布于 2017-02-12 00:06:35
这是谷歌在https://developer.android.com/studio/intro/studio-config.html上说的
最新版本的OpenJDK与AndroidStudio2.2及更高版本捆绑在一起,这是我们建议您在安卓项目中使用的JDK版本。
因此,如果您使用的是最新版本的,那么您将不需要任何额外的JDK。此外,与2016年6月相比,正式的安装说明不再包含任何关于JDK的提示。
发布于 2019-03-06 19:43:43
在Mac上,可以使用以下导出命令设置Android的Java环境的路径:
导出JAVA_HOME=/Applications/Android\ Studio.app/Contents/jre/jdk/Contents/Home/
这使用了Android附带的JAVA (OpenJDK)。
https://stackoverflow.com/questions/42172010
复制相似问题